Practical Designer Notes for Real Projects
Before finalizing any use of TWO HALF HEART and HOLIDAY ELEMENTS, it’s wise to test it on real packaging mockups. Check how it looks in black and white, and preview it on small labels to ensure it remains legible. Test it with your brand colors to see how it integrates with your existing palette.
Compare it with competitor packaging to ensure it stands out while still fitting within your industry standards. Review PNG transparency to confirm it works well for digital use, and inspect SVG or vector editability if you plan to modify the design.
Also, test it beside different font styles—serif, sans serif, script, handwritten, and display fonts—to see how it complements your typography. Finally, always confirm commercial licensing before using it for client work, business branding, or physical product sales.
